The World is a Queer Place
The world is a queer place
  People move
  They share their stories
  And people applaud
  Like hardship
  Is to be celebrated
  We put dust on our face
  And smudge black on our eyelids
  “Oh, you look pretty today.”
  How strange
  We ring brass against brass
  To warn of many things
  Invaders are coming
  Sunday, the day of Jesus Christ
  We put glass to our eyelids
  To see from afar
  For what?
  Nothing
  Little metal fingers
  Tell us when it's time
  To leave to a building
  To read papers
  Send emails
  Take phone calls
  And get paid
  We take the fur of another creature
  And put it on our backs
  To warm us
  We make colors out of eggs
  And splash them on trees
  And praise it
  People do strange things
  When they're afraid
  They use tiny metal weapons
  To kill people
  They make fear grow
  Men sit in chairs
  And argue and yell
  It's words, all words
  Heroes, people say
  Because their words
  Sound pretty
  We make symbols
  And they make us cry
  And laugh
  How odd
  How we hallucinate
  Staring at paper
  
  We find creative ways
  Just to kill ourselves
  Inhaling intoxicating plants
  And wrapping ropes
  Around our necks
  Wars are fought
  Over screens
  Or with guns
  We make things
  Just to kill more people
The world is a queer place
